There are some hardware resource or software entity is created on the driver runtime. But DT or DT overlays are compiled before device driver get loaded. GPIO-emulated-I2C is just an example, this is kind of driver level knowledge on the runtime. With the GPIO or programmable some hardware IP unit, device driver authors can change the connection relationship at their will at the runtime. While with DT, every thing has to be sure before the compile time. DT overlays can be a alternative solution, but this doesn't conflict with this patch. This patch won't assume how device drives go to use it, and allow device driver creating device instead enumerating by DT. In one word: "flexibility". -- Best regards, Sui
